What have you seen in Brown that makes her a better fit than a 6-5 player who can score, rebound, block shots, handle the ball and shoot the 3-ball?

With the makeup of UConn's roster going forward I just think Brown will fit better at UConn because she is a post that does her best work from the foul line and in. Brown is refined in her post footwork and her finishing skills with either hand are second to none. Her basketball IQ is off the charts and she has a knack for always being in good position for rebounds{like Kiah Stokes}. She is a good passer and a great defender primarily relying on her size and positioning. While I think Wilson will be a good player I also think her ball handling and jump shooting is not good enough for her to play the 3 at the next level like she wants to. I am not saying she is going to be a bad player by any means I am just saying I think UConn will benefit more from a post like Brown that will do most of her work on the inside.

<<...she stated she does NOT want to to be a post player.... CT need for a post player could be a big reason she doesn't come here.>>

I'm not sure that Geno has ever locked into espousing "traditional" post player (ie Center) use.
It seems he creates a "5" according to the talent he has/develops.

When Stef was a newbie, Frosh body-banger, she played in one fashion... As she (literally) remolded herself, the style of UConn play changed with her. When she unveiled her polished 18' jump shot, her role metamorphosed... incorporating the multi-threat high post - shoot or assist. (This, of course, through no coincidence, intertwined with the advent of Stewie's ability.)

If A'ja wants to create a new breakthrough in WBB... a "4 1/2" role, she and Stewie could become interchangeable threats at the 4 1/2 ..."Court Wraith" position.
